Healthcare Infection Control Challenges
HAI Prevention
Healthcare-associated infections affect 1 in 31 hospital patients. Effective sanitization protocols are critical for patient safety and quality metrics.
CMS Compliance
CMS surveys evaluate infection control practices. Having documented, compliant products and protocols is essential for maintaining certification.
Staff Compliance
Hand hygiene compliance rates directly impact infection rates. Products must be effective, gentle on skin, and readily accessible.

What is the difference between sanitizers and disinfectants in healthcare?
Sanitizers reduce bacteria to safe levels, while disinfectants kill or inactivate bacteria, viruses, and fungi. In healthcare settings, disinfectants are typically required for patient care areas, while sanitizers may be appropriate for non-critical surfaces.
